PROJECT ROSE
Spoken, WA
The electrical portion of this four-story,
2.65
million
square-foot
distribution
warehouse included robotics storage
platforms, processing conveyor levels,
and multiple office spaces. The team also
installed and commissioned power for
approximately
600
workstations
and
over 70 charging stations for the robotics
equipment. In addition, fire alarm and
radio amplification life-safety systems
were self-performed.
IMPA RICHMOND SOLAR
Richmond, IN
This project began on 45 acres of sandy
terrain, requiring thousands of support
posts. Once all of the underground was
in place, then began wiring of the 22,000
pieces of solar glass panels. Instead of
the typical daisy-chain approach, our
team used a method known as “skipstring cabling”, ultimately saving the
customer 100,000 feet of extra wire and
allowing easy maintenance access.
